Remembrance Sunday in Milnrow
Date published: 08 November 2015
The people of Milnrow paid their respects to those who died in the service of their country this morning (Sunday 8 November) at the annual remembrance service.
The procession was led by Milnrow Band and the Service of Remembrance conducted by Father Morley Morgan.
The last post was sounded followed by a two minute silence and the laying of wreaths.
